Full Recipe:
Ingredients:
-
1 ½ lbs chicken tenders
-
8 oz cream cheese, softened
-
1 packet ranch seasoning mix
-
1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
-
6 slices cooked bacon, crumbled
-
½ tsp garlic powder
-
½ tsp onion powder
-
½ tsp smoked paprika
-
Salt and pepper, to taste
-
1 tbsp chopped parsley (optional for garnish)
Directions:
-
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C). Lightly grease a baking dish or line with parchment paper.
-
In a medium bowl, mix cream cheese, ranch seasoning, cheddar cheese, garlic powder, onion powder, and smoked paprika until well combined.
-
Place chicken tenders in the baking dish. Season with salt and pepper.
-
Evenly spread the cream cheese mixture over the chicken tenders.
-
Sprinkle crumbled bacon over the top.
-
Bake for 25–30 minutes, or until chicken is fully cooked and topping is golden and bubbly.
-
Garnish with chopped parsley and serve warm.
Prep Time: 10 minutes | Cooking Time: 30 minutes | Total Time: 40 minutes
Kcal: 420 kcal | Servings: 4 servings

Origins and Popularity
Crack Chicken originated as a slow cooker recipe that quickly went viral on Pinterest and Facebook around 2017. The original version involved shredded chicken cooked with cream cheese, ranch seasoning, and bacon. Over time, home cooks adapted the recipe to create different variations including casseroles, dips, and now, these crave-worthy tenders.
The tender version rose in popularity because it’s fast, oven-baked, and offers a better texture for those who prefer solid chicken bites over shredded meat. It also works better for meal prep, lunchboxes, or as finger food for parties and potlucks.

Easy to Customize
One of the best aspects of Crack Chicken Tenders is their versatility. Here are a few ideas to switch things up without losing the essence of the dish:
-
Spicy Version: Add chopped jalapeños, hot sauce, or red pepper flakes to the cream cheese mix for a little heat.
-
Extra Veggies: Finely diced green onions, spinach, or bell peppers can be folded into the cheese mixture to sneak in extra nutrients.
-
Different Cheeses: While cheddar is classic, you can try Monterey Jack, pepper jack, or a sharp aged gouda for a flavor twist.
-
Air Fryer Option: These can be made in the air fryer for an even quicker version that delivers extra crispiness.
These tweaks make the recipe feel new every time you make it, and they cater to a wide variety of palates and dietary needs.

Tips for the Perfect Crack Chicken Tenders
To ensure your tenders come out perfectly every time, keep these tips in mind:
-
Use Room Temperature Cream Cheese: It blends better and spreads more easily over the chicken.
-
Don’t Skip the Bacon: It adds necessary crunch and smoky flavor.
-
Avoid Overbaking: Chicken tenders cook quickly. Check for doneness at 25 minutes to prevent drying out.
-
Let It Rest: Give it 5 minutes out of the oven to let the cheese set before serving.
-
Use a Rimmed Baking Sheet: This prevents any cheesy overflow from spilling into your oven.
These little details make a big difference in the texture and flavor of the final dish.
